Bowles and Carver

"Partnership of (Henry) Carington Bowles II (1763-c.1830; son of Carington Bowles I, q.v.) and Samuel Carver (q.v.), continuing the Bowles business in St Paul's Churchyard, London, 1793-1832. In 1818, Bowles built Myddelton House in Enfield.
A view of the shop when trading as Bowles and Carver appears in Thomas Hornor's Prospectus: View of London and the surrounding country, 1823 (reproduced in D. Hodson, County Atlases of the British Isles, 1984)
Bill-head in Banks Collection (D,2.3392) states "Bought of Bowles & Carver at Their Map & Print Warehouse..."
This entry is used for the partnership as publishers; see a separate entry for Henry Carington Bowles as an indivdual." - https://www.britishmuseum.org/research/search_the_collection_database/term_details.aspx?bioId=93943
